Scott Snyder and Rafael Albuquerque s Eisner Award-winning chronicle of their uniquely original vampire history continues in this second massive collection of their DC Vertigo series! American Vampire debuted in 2010, as then-budding superstars Scott Snyder and Rafael Albuquerque teamed up to introduce readers to a new breed of vampire, telling their story over multiple decades of American history. This second, nearly 400-page volume collecting the acclaimed series stars Pearl and her husband Henry as he is recruited by a mysterious group of vampire hunters to World War II Japan to find a new breed of blood sucker. But what does the notorious vampire Skinner Sweet have to do with it? Later, the action moves to the early 1800s, as Snyder is joined by legendary artist Jordi Bernet for a story detailing Skinner Sweet s origins. Plus, Snyder teams with Sean Murphy of the bestselling Batman: White Knight for companion series American Vampire: Survival of the Fittest, a companion series featuring secret organization Vassals of the Morningstar, also included in this collection. This volume collects American Vampire #13 25 and American Vampire: Survival of the Fittest #1 5.

Scott Snyder has written comics for both DC and Marvel, including the Eisner Award-winning series American Vampire and acclaimed runs on iconic characters Batman, Swamp Thing, and more. Wytches, a series created by Snyder and superstar artist Jock, is in development as an animated series at Amazon Prime. In 2024, Snyder returned to DC to reinvent the Dark Knight in the bestselling series Absolute Batman. He lives on Long Island with his wife, Jeanie, and his sons, Jack and Emmett.
